Waste Reduction Tips

In addition to recycling, the City of Lawrence encourages its citizen to reduce the amount of waste generated.

Waste Reduction Tips
  • Ask yourself if you really need the product.
  • Bring your own canvas tote bags instead of using a paper or plastic bag
  • Use cloth napkins instead of paper napkins
  • Use durable products rather than disposable (e.g., plates, utensils, cloth towel, refillable pens, lighters, razors)
  • Use old cotton t-shirts for rags
  • Pack a no-waste lunch
  • Tell the cashier that you don’t need a bag for small purchases
  • Avoid products with excess packaging
  • Skip the individual plastic product bags
  • Skip the bottled water and bring your own from home.
  • Borrow books from the library rather than purchasing them.
  • Carry and use a reusable mug or cup at work or school
  • Maintain your vehicle
